Jump to content


Photo

Users Online


  • Faça o login para participar
1 reply to this topic

#1 WeeD

WeeD

    12 Horas

  • Usuários
  • 166 posts
  • Sexo:Não informado

Posted 11/12/2004, 00:05

Ae alguem pode me da um help aqui fazendo favor, tipo eu tava tentando faze esse sitema de usuarios online com db e tal, só que to tendo problemas. é o seguinte quando eu me logo ele imprimi ali meu nome de usuario normal a contagem tambem, só que quando outra pessoa se loga junto comigo pro exemplo tem eu e mais um "MEMBRO" online, ele só mostra eu e na maquina do cara mostra só ele online, e tbm não aparece que tem visitante online. outra coisa é que quando eu do um "reflash" na pagina ele duplica o registro de user online. alguem pode me da uma força fazendo favor. :)

<%
IF Session("sesaousuario") = "" THEN
usuario = "Nenhum"
ELSE
usuario = Session("sesaousuario")
END IF
horas = Time()
ip = Request.ServerVariables("REMOTE_ADDR")
conexao.execute("INSERT INTO users_online (usuario,ip,horas) VALUES ('"&usuario&"','"&ip&"','"&horas&"')")
set rs = conexao.execute("SELECT * FROM online")
While Not rs.EOF
Response.Write(""&usuario&"")
rs.movenext
Wend
%>
<%
sql = ("SELECT DISTINCT ip FROM users_online WHERE usuario <> '' AND usuario <> 'nenhum'")
set rs = server.createobject("adodb.recordset")
rs.open sql,conexao,3,3
Response.Write("Cadastrados: "<b>"&rs.recordcount&"<b>"") 
%>
<%
rs.close 
set rs = nothing
sql = ("SELECT DISTINCT ip FROM users_online WHERE usuario = '' OR usuario = 'nenhum'")
set rs = Server.Createobject("adodb.recordset")
rs.open sql,conexao,3,3 
Response.Write("Visitantes: "<b>"&rs.recordcount&"<b>"")
%>
<%
rs.close
set rs = nothing
sql = ("SELECT DISTINCT ip FROM users_online")
set rs = server.createobject("adodb.recordset")
rs.open sql,Conexao,3,3 
Response.Write("Total: "<b>"&rs.recordcount&"<b>"")
%>
<% 
END IF
rs.close 
set rs = nothing
%>

Edição feita por: WeeD, 11/12/2004, 00:07.

còé ?

#2 WeeD

WeeD

    12 Horas

  • Usuários
  • 166 posts
  • Sexo:Não informado

Posted 13/12/2004, 18:21

tem algum geito de arrumar isso ? :/
còé ?




1 user(s) are reading this topic

0 membro(s), 1 visitante(s) e 0 membros anônimo(s)

IPB Skin By Virteq